下载服务器 linux系统,如何搭建Linux服务器
以Linux为基础的“LAMP(Linux, Apache, MySQL, Perl/PHP/Python的组合)”经典技术组合,提供了包括操作系统、数据库、网站服务器、动态网页的一整套网站架设支持。
主要介绍如何搭建Linux服务器,文档详细地进行了讲解,使用者按照步骤来即可完成整个搭建过程。
目录:
1、搭建telnet服务器
2、搭建DHCP服务器
3、搭建DNS服务器
4、搭建sendmail服务器
5、搭建FTP服务器
6、搭建web服务器 安装apache tomcat
7、搭建samba服务器
使用Linux服务器有什么好处?
1. 免费:LuManager所支持的系统都是免费的,如Zijidelu/FreeBSD/CentOS/Debian/Ubuntu等。
2. 开源:作为普通用户,我们不必懂。这是集成了全世界很多高手的智慧也开发的系统,一旦发现漏洞,会及时打补丁。
3. 安全:病毒对这些开源系统几乎无计可施,如果不是网站程序本身或FTP密码被盗,网站被挂木马的可能性非常小。
4. 高效:不管是LAMP还是LNMP、FAMP、FNMP,效率都非常不错,在这里,我们懒得拿别的组合来比,哈哈。
5. 稳定:两年不重启是常有的事;很久不用管而忘记服务器密码也不是什么新鲜事;在这里不得不提一下FreeBSD,它是被称作坚如磐石的稳定系统。
6. 轻便:最小化安装FreeBSD后,占用的磁盘空间只有125M左右!安装速度也快,5分钟便可以将系统装好。
搭建Linux服务器:
一、搭建telnet服务器
1、查看是否有telnet服务
rpm –qa|grep telnet
显示:telnet-0.17-39.el5 还需安装telnet-server-0.17-39.el5
2、挂载
mkdir /mnt/cdrom
mount –t iso9660 /dev/cdrom /mnt/cdrom
3、找到server文件夹
cd /mnt/cdrom/Server
4、安装telnet服务
ls telnet*
rpm –ivh telnet-server-0.17-39.el5.i386.rpm
5、检查安装
rpm -qa|grep telnet
6、开启23端口
chkconfig --list 查看端口是否开启
chkconfig telnet on 或 service telnet start 或 ntsysv
7、用“telnet ip地址”登录,退出ctrl + D
二、搭建DHCP服务器
1、查看是否有DHCP服务
rpm –qa|grep dhcpt
2、挂载
mkdir /mnt/cdrom
mount –t iso9660 /dev/cdrom /mnt/cdrom
3、找到server文件夹
cd /mnt/cdrom/Server
4、安装dhcp服务
ls dhcp*
rpm –ivh dhcp-3.05-18.el5.i386.rpm
5、检查安装。
rpm -qa|grep dhcp
6、配置文件
实例文件vi /usr/share/doc/dhcp-3.05/dhcpd.conf.sample
租约实效文件vi /var/lib/dhcpd/dhcpd.leases
复制配置文件
cp /usr/share/doc/dhcp-3.05/dhcpd.conf.sample /etc/dhcpd.conf
vi /etc/dhcpd.conf
①修改子网subnet、子网掩码netmask、路由routers、dns服务器
三、搭建DMS服务器
1、查看是否有dns服务
rpm –qa|grep bind
2、挂载
mkdir /mnt/cdrom
mount –t iso9660 /dev/cdrom /mnt/cdrom
3、找到server文件夹
cd /mnt/cdrom/Server
4、安装dns服务
ls bind*
rpm –ivh bind-9.3.4-10.el5.i386.rpm
rpm –ivh bind-chroot-9.3.4-10.p1.el5.i386.rpm
ls caching*
rpm –ivh caching-nameserver-9.3.4-10.p1.el5.i386.rpm
5、检查安装
rpm -qa|grep bind
rpm -qa|grep caching
6、4个配置文件
(1)cd /var/named/chroot/etc
复制主配置文件 cp -p named.caching-nameserver.conf named.conf
vi named.conf
修改15行为 listen-on port 53 { any; };
27行为 allow-query { any; };
(2)cd /var/named/chroot/etc
vi named.rfc1912.zones
修改正向、逆向文件的名称
(3)配置正向解析文件
cd /var/named/chroot/var/named
cp -p localdomain.zone fendou.zone(正向解析文件名)
vi fendou.zone (正向解析文件名)
(4)配置逆向解析文件
cd /var/named/chroot/var/named
cp -p named.local 11.168.192(逆向解析文件名)
vi 11.168.192(逆向解析文件名)
7、开启端口
chkconfig --list 查看端口是否开启
chkconfig named on 或 service named start 或 ntsysv
四、搭建sendmail服务器
先在named.rfc1912.zones文件中添加正向、逆向区域,并在正向、逆向文件中加入相应内容。
(一)安装sendmail
1、查看是否有sendmail服务
rpm –qa|grep sendmail
2、挂载
mkdir /mnt/cdrom
mount –t iso9660 /dev/cdrom /mnt/cdrom
3、找到server文件夹
cd /mnt/cdrom/Server
4、安装sendmail服务
下载服务器 linux系统,如何搭建Linux服务器相关推荐
- XP系统如搭建ftp服务器,XP系统如搭建ftp服务器
XP系统如搭建ftp服务器 内容精选 换一换 ISO是一种光盘映像文件,通过特定的压缩方式,将大量的数据文件统一为一个后缀名为iso的映像文件.ISO文件可以理解为从光盘中复制出来的数据文件,所以IS ...
- 怎样给云机房服务器做系统,如何搭建云服务器机房
如何搭建云服务器机房 内容精选 换一换 Linux操作系统下,用户由于误操作卸载弹性云服务器上的Tools,会对非PVOPS系统的磁盘和网卡产生影响,导致系统无法发现数据盘.此时,用户可通过新建一个弹 ...
- 玩客云刷入Linux系统,搭建FTP服务器
玩客云刷入LINUX系统参考这篇博客:https://lishuma.com/archives/3412 根据上面大佬的博客一步一步来很简单,简要总结几点: 1: 先刷安卓固件包,然后刷armbian ...
- Linux系统下搭建常用服务器
1.搭建telnet服务器 2.搭建DHCP服务器 3.搭建DNS服务器 4.搭建sendmail服务器 5.搭建FTP服务器 6.搭建web服务器 安装 apache tomcat 7.搭建samb ...
- linux ftp web服务器搭建,Linux系统下搭建Web服务器和FTP服务器
8种机械键盘轴体对比 本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选? Apache2和php组件的安装 使用如下命令来安装Apache2和php的组件 Ps:如果只安装Apache2,将会导 ...
- Linux系统开发: 搭建NFS服务器实现文件共享
一.NFS服务器介绍 1.1 什么是NFS服务器 NFS 是Network File System的缩写,即网络文件系统.一种使用于分散式文件系统的协定,由Sun公司开发,于1984年向外公布.功能是 ...
- deepin改无盘服务器,UbuntuDeepin系统上搭建nfs服务器
前言 我使用的deepin,当然Ubuntu16.04安装使用也是一样,给朋友实践过了. nfs介绍 NFS(Network File System)即网络文件系统,是FreeBSD支持的文件系统中的 ...
- boa服务器 系统设置,boa服务器在linux系统下搭建
boa服务器在linux系统下搭建 内容精选 换一换 制作Docker镜像,有以下两种方法.快照方式制作镜像(偶尔制作的镜像):在基础镜像上,比如Ubuntu,先登录镜像系统并安装Docker软件,然 ...
- 空服务器安装linux,debian服务器linux服务器web建站搭建linux服务器之Debian安装
debian服务器linux服务器web建站搭建linux服务器之Debian安装 原文来自i火吧 大家都知道linux的发行版本很多,有centos啊,debian啊,ubuntu等,下面我就用de ...
最新文章
- value_counts()
- 如何用Python快速抓取Google搜索?
- C#统计子字符串出现次数(转帖,http://www.it130.cn/)
- ​EMNLP 2021 | 以对比损失为微调目标,UMass提出更强大的短语表示模型
- mysql 事务权限_0428-mysql(事务、权限)
- swift版的GCD封装
- linux中查看相关日志记录,linux重启查看日志及历史记录 查询原因
- 安装kloxo。需要注意的事项
- 三国树状信息展示 winform
- cluster oracle修改,Oracle 修改集群的资源属性(依赖关系)
- python字符串、字符串处理函数及字符串相关操作
- 【4】Kafka集群启动/关闭脚本
- 第5讲 zend原理深度剖析
- java 整形数据类型_3.2Java基本数据类型之整型
- 6月第3周网络安全报告:境内感染网络病毒主机55.4万
- oppo计算机锁屏快捷键,oppo一键锁屏方法【图文教程】
- 【常用0x000000类型颜色代码表】
- Windows右键菜单项管理讲解(RightMenuMgr)
- 关于网络口碑研究小组
- HTML5期末大作业:生态环境网站设计——环境保护主题-绿色环保 (9页) web期末作业设计网页_绿色环保大学生网页设计作业成品
热门文章
- PDF页眉页脚怎么设置
- nginx服务器绑定域名和设置根目录的方法
- php动物书总结01-06
- javax.net.ssl.SSLHandshakeException(Cas导入证书)
- dubbo+zookeeper+dubbo管理控制台实践demo
- 【Android】3.12 兴趣点( POI)搜索功能
- 由Photoshop高反差保留算法原理联想到的一些图像增强算法。
- Oracle常用语句记录
- 【ArcGIS 10.2新特性】Geodatabase 10.2 常见问题
- JS 全局对象 全局变量 作用域 (改自TOM大叔博文)